//! pdftract SDK Conformance Test Runner (Rust reference implementation) //! //! This is the reference implementation of the conformance test runner pattern. //! Every SDK should implement a similar test harness that: //! 1. Loads tests/sdk-conformance/cases.json //! 2. Iterates through test cases //! 3. Executes each case with the SDK's native API //! 4. Compares results against expected values with tolerances //! 5. Reports pass/fail/skip/error status //! 6.
